SDVI elevates Eldridge to COO
SDVI has elevated one of its co-founders, Simon Eldridge, to the position of chief operating officer. In this new role, he will oversee all functions except finance and accounting for the company. Eldridge is one of three company founders and has been serving as chief product officer. He will continue to report to Larry Kaplan, who remains in his roles as chairman and chief executive officer.
“Simon has been an invaluable leader for the company since day one and I am delighted to elevate his role to chief operating officer,” said Kaplan. “In this new role, he will focus on driving operational execution across all our key functions, including engineering, sales, marketing and customer success.”
In a corresponding move, SDVI has also promoted Chris Brähler, who previously served as vice president of product, to the post of chief product officer. In this position, he will continue to drive product strategy and execution and own the product roadmap while working closely with customers and the company’s solutions team to define new product requirements.
“As I move into my new role, I’m excited to be able to promote Chris into the chief product officer position,” commented Eldridge. “I’ve worked extremely closely with Chris for several years to make the Rally platform into the market leader it is today. I couldn’t imagine anyone more capable and deserving of taking the reins on this important position for the company.”
